Transaction 105fc17b8243529f2b6101d21dcbaaad441e3d3ca750fa8a845cbb209e2fa004
1 Input
1 Output
-
105fc17b8243529f2b6101d21dcbaaad441e3d3ca750fa8a845cbb209e2fa004:0
- value
- 13125000
- script pubkey
- OP_0 OP_PUSHBYTES_20 763112ea9c58e3cf4d645379009cbd77823631fe
- address
- bc1qwcc3965utr3u7nty2dusp89aw7prvv07p76yc3